KIM
KREJUS
Kim Krejus is
an AFI nominee and an extremely experienced and
committed
acting teacher who brings a wealth of knowledge with her
from
having studied at the world's best acting schools. She
has studied
at NIDA, the Drama Centre in London, at the HB
studios
in New York with Uta Hagan and with Phillipe
Gaulier in
Paris as well as the prestigious Atlantic Theatre
Company
Acting School in NY.
Whilst living in the US she toured the country in the Broadway
production "Noises Of" and since returning to
Australia
has worked on many Australian productions including CBS
telemovie
"The Flood" for Warner Bros and has been
employed as an acting coach on feature film "Aquamarine"
for Fox Studios. She has taught at NIDA, VCA,
Central
Queensland Uni and the National Theatre and
is qualified
to teach Practical Aesthetics technique in
Victoria.
In 2009 Kim returned from Los Angeles where she trained
under
master acting coach Ivana Chubbuck who has
trained professional
actors such as Halle Berry, Brad Pitt and Charlize
Theron (to
name a few), Kim has been endorsed to train the Ivana
Chubbuck
technique in Australia.
